Output 424247e45cb407f7025144c889f0c5f1e76c30abf55163946930b9204e799a96:3

value
28000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 659ba4633406d487db0d4d56d2dcce11fffb3766 OP_EQUALVERIFY OP_CHECKSIG
address
1AGFhaez1BbihxMTnJqyWG3k1VcdiLTmH6
transaction
424247e45cb407f7025144c889f0c5f1e76c30abf55163946930b9204e799a96
spent
true